How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Big Pool?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Big Pool Studio Apartments | $980 | $980 | $980 |
Big Pool 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,361 | $975 | $1,735 |
Big Pool 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,608 | $1,099 | $2,625 |
Big Pool 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,797 | $1,295 | $2,965 |
Big Pool 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,385 | $2,000 | $2,574 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Big Pool Apartments with Washer/Dryer
How much is the average rent for Big Pool Apartments with Washer/Dryer?
The average rent for a Apartment in Big Pool with Washer/Dryer is $1,612.
What is the largest Big Pool Apartment for rent with Washer/Dryer?
Today's Apartment with Washer/Dryer and the most square footage in Big Pool is a 2,650 square feet unit starting from $1,060 at Rosewood Village.
What is the average size for Big Pool Apartments for rent with Washer/Dryer?
The average size for a rental with Washer/Dryer in Big Pool is currently at 967 sq ft.
